Pue Data Center Definition

Awasome Pue Data Center Definition 2022. Power usage effectiveness (pue) is the overall building power (or energy) divided by the it power within the building. Pue is considered the defacto metric by the data center industry, and in 2016 became an iso standard (iso/iec30134).
